Mazda 3 Service Manual: Power Window Subswitch Removal/Installation

Mazda 3 Service Manual / Body / Glass & Windows / Power Window Subswitch Removal/Installation

Passenger's Side

1. Disconnect the negative battery cable..

2. Remove the inner garnish..

3. Remove the front door trim..

4. Remove the power window subswitch..

5. Install in the reverse order of removal.

Rear

1. Disconnect the negative battery cable..

2. Remove the rear door trim..

3. Remove the power window subswitch..

4. Install in the reverse order of removal.
